Parineeti Chopra reveals how Alia Bhatt and Aditya Roy Kapur introduced her to an alcoholic lifestyle
Parineeti Chopra, who is currently shooting for Rohit Shetty's 'Golmaal Again', recently was a part of Neha Dhupia's popular podcast show, '#NoFilterNeha'. While the actress is known for her candid nature, her most recent interview with Neha is already turning heads. During the course of the conversation, Parineeti revealed that ace tennis star, Sania Mirza wants the actress to play her in her biopic, as both the ladies are blessed in the 'chest area'.

Continuing her string of revelations, Parineeti further that while she was abstinent to alcohol earlier, her buddies, Alia Bhatt and Aditya Roy Kapur introduced her to the bottle. Parineeti revealed, "It was the end of Dream Team and Alia and Aditya and Varun and me, everybody was partying. Sid and Katrina had already left. So, four of us we went to this club and everybody was like today Pari has to drink and I’m like no guys, I don’t drink alcohol so it’s not going to happen. This is like 10 months ago. They were like no, no, you have to drink. A couple of my other friends and Alia and Aditya and everybody they all said okay, we’re all going to do jäger bombs and they made one jäger bomb for me and I said okay cool, I’ll have it. I hate the taste of it, I hate the smell but I’ll do it and I had it and 15 mins later they were like – anything?! I was like no, nothing, I’m fine. Like, see, there’s no point of alcohol in life and lalala. And they were like you gotta do another one and they gave me a second one.”

Parineeti further added, " I have danced till 6 a.m. the next day, I have gone down to the lobby and hugged everyone. I’ve given so much love and the next day I’ve woken up like WOW, that was so much fun! I want to do this again. And there started my alcohol lifestyle."
